Things to Do around Schwarzenberg am Böhmerwald

Schwarzenberg am Böhmerwald is a region in the Upper Mühlviertel of Austria, characterized by its location in the "border triangle" where Austria meets Germany and the Czech Republic. The area is defined by its extensive forest landscapes and mountainous terrain, forming a significant part of the Bohemian Forest. Natural features like the Plöckenstein, the highest elevation in the Bohemian Forest, and the Dreiländereck, a unique geographical point, contribute to diverse outdoor activity options. What are the main natural landmarks in Schwarzenberg am Böhmerwald?

Key natural landmarks include the Plöckenstein, the highest peak in the Bohemian Forest at 4,524 feet (1379 meters), and the Dreiländereck, marking the border intersection of Austria, Germany, and the Czech Republic. The region also features extensive forest landscapes and viewpoints offering vistas of Lipno Lake.

What is the Dreiländereck in Schwarzenberg am Böhmerwald?

The Dreiländereck is a unique geographical point where the borders of Austria, Germany, and the Czech Republic meet. It is a significant hiking destination, offering impressive rock formations and panoramic views. The area includes the Dreisessel Rock and the "Stone Sea," a cluster of large granite rocks.

What is the Plöckenstein?

The Plöckenstein is the highest elevation in the Bohemian Forest, reaching 4,524 feet (1379 meters). It is a prominent natural feature in the region, with several well-marked hiking trails leading to its summit. These trails provide extensive views of the surrounding landscape.
